2011-12-14 17 views
3

ASP.NETアプリケーションでNGENを使用して起動時間を改善しようとしています。ASP.NETが動作しているNGenを取得できない

ターゲットDLLに対してnGENを実行することができ、「すべてのコンパイルターゲットが最新である」というメッセージが表示されています。

ただし、アプリケーションを起動してアセンブリのバインディングログビューア(ログカテゴリのネイティブイメージをチェック)を使用してこれが機能しているかどうかを確認しようとすると、アプリケーションがリストされていないことがわかります何らかの理由で動作していません。

NGENの画像が使用されているかどうかを確認できる方法を知っている人は誰でも分かりません。

+0

ASP.NET(したがって、一時的なASP.NETフォルダで作成されたDLL)のビューなどの動的コンパイルが欠けていますか? – Aliostad

+0

Viewsがプレコンパイルされていない場合は、それは意味ですか? –

+0

私たちはしません。 ASP.NETはそれを行うhttp://msdn.microsoft.com/en-us/library/ms366723.aspx – Aliostad

答えて

0

hereをご覧ください。

ASP.NETアプリケーションとNGENを事前にコンパイルすると、探しているものを達成できます。

+0

NGENの利点を活用する前に、ASP.NETアプリケーションをあらかじめコンパイルする必要がありますか? –

+0

これは完全な利点が得られる場所です。 – Aliostad

+0

しかし、私はプリコンパイルせずにいくつかの利点を得ることができますか? –

関連する問題